In Wheatstone bridge, three resistors P,Q and R are conncected in three arms in order and 4th arm of resistance s, is formed by two resistors s₁ and s₂ connected in parallel. The condition for bridge to be balanced is, P/Q
Options
(a) R(s₁+s₂)/s₁s₂
(b) s₁s₂/R(s₁+s₂)
(c) R(s₁s₂)/(s₁+s₂)
(d) (s₁+s₂)R(s₁s₂)
Correct Answer:
R(s₁+s₂)/s₁s₂
